Transaction 3834e1618db55a65876c73b976c55971f861dfc3a3f8cfece190074799907e21

2 Input
2 Outputs
  • 3834e1618db55a65876c73b976c55971f861dfc3a3f8cfece190074799907e21:0
  • value  1373441
    address  382nM3K4hMhPw1TxCKxyA5TQbuNXLC34xd
  • 3834e1618db55a65876c73b976c55971f861dfc3a3f8cfece190074799907e21:1
  • value  184060
    address  1DQoMNFBvPb8HphQJm3Z9CEqPaXDonS2Tz